Security and Fairness

Online casinos take security and fairness seriously, with robust measures in place to protect your personal and financial information. Look for a casino that uses encryption technology to secure your data and has a strong reputation for fairness and honesty. You should also check the casino’s licensing and regulation, as well as any independent audits or testing.

Additionally, you can take steps to ensure your own security and fairness, such as using strong and unique passwords, enabling two-factor authentication, and keeping your software and browser up to date. You should also be aware of the risks associated with online gambling and set limits for yourself to avoid problem gambling.
